So I’m at home this evening packing for the TOE (trans oceanic experience) trip.

I guess I’m a little more careful packing for the trip because it’s not like if I forget something, that I can hop down to the “Monoprix” and find exactly what I left behind in the US.

Basically, tomorrow, I’m flying from PHX to CVG to position for the trip. Then the next evening, I meet up with Staplegun and the training Captain for my flight to Paris.

It’s pretty exciting. It’s a 48 hour layover at a great hotel in Paris so I’m bringing Kristie along. The only ‘catch’ is that I’ll be on a private van, inaccessible to ‘civilians’ and Kristie’s riding the RER down to central Paris. She’s done it before a million times in Paris, but it’s just a wee bit different leaving your wife behind at the airport.

Tomorrow, I’ll most likely study for the Paris flight enroute to Cincinnati, reviewing the things I learned during the two-day transoceanic crash course so the check airman doesn’t think that I’m a COMPLETE idiot when it comes time to pick up the North Atlantic Track message, etc.
